Overview of Instrument Calibration Management Software Market

The instrument calibration management software market encompasses digital platforms designed to streamline and automate the calibration, maintenance, and compliance processes for measuring instruments and equipment. These solutions facilitate scheduling, record-keeping, reporting, and audit readiness, ensuring accuracy and regulatory adherence across industries.

Core products include calibration scheduling tools, asset management modules, real-time monitoring systems, and compliance reporting features. Key end-use industries span manufacturing, pharmaceuticals, healthcare, aerospace, automotive, and research laboratories, where precise measurement and regulatory compliance are critical. The importance of this market lies in its ability to reduce operational downtime, improve measurement accuracy, and ensure adherence to stringent industry standards, thereby supporting the global economy’s productivity and safety standards.

Instrument Calibration Management Software Market Dynamics

The value chain of calibration management software is influenced by macroeconomic factors such as industrial growth, technological innovation, and regulatory frameworks, which drive demand across sectors. Microeconomic factors include enterprise-specific needs for compliance, operational efficiency, and cost reduction. The supply-demand balance is maintained through continuous software upgrades, cloud deployment models, and increasing customization options to meet diverse industry requirements.

The regulatory environment, characterized by standards like ISO 17025 and FDA regulations, mandates rigorous calibration protocols, thereby fueling market growth. Technological advancements, particularly in IoT, AI, and cloud computing, have significantly enhanced software capabilities, enabling real-time data analytics, predictive maintenance, and seamless integration with existing enterprise systems. These factors collectively shape a dynamic ecosystem that supports ongoing innovation and market expansion.
